University Of Southern Maine Foundation
University Of Southern Maine Foundation reported paying Ainsley Newman Wallace, President & Ceo (Thru 9/30/24), $202,500 in total compensation (FY 2025).
That places Ainsley Newman Wallace at approximately the 52nd percentile among 243 similarly sized philanthropy & grantmaking nonprofits (median $196,478).
